Administrative Assistant - French Speaking

**PRIMARY PURPOSE** **:** To provide administrative support including preparing correspondence and reports, filing, and other general office support activities.

**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S and RESPONSIBILITIES**

+ Produces correspondence, reports, and other documentation; files documents, maintains and tracks suspense file, photocopies, sends and receives facsimile transmissions, etc.

+ Provides back-up telephone support.

+ Processes invoices and billings; maintains records.

+ Maintains unit attendance records, library and/or manuals.

+ Records meeting minutes.

+ Makes travel arrangements.

+ Maintains adequate supply inventory; orders supplies as needed.

**ADDITIONAL FUNCTIONS and RESPONSIBILITIES**

+ Performs other duties as assigned.

+ Supports the organization's quality program(s).

**QUALIFICATIONS**

**Education & Licensing**

High school diploma or GED required.

**Experience**

One (1) year of experience in general office administrative duties or equivalent combination of education and experience required. Experience with an insurance company, broker or consultant preferred.

**Skills & Knowledge**

+ Excellent oral and written communication, including presentation skills

+ PC literate, including Microsoft Office products

+ Analytical and interpretive skills

+ Strong organizational skills

+ Good interpersonal skills

+ Ability to work in a team environment

+ Ability to meet or exceed Performance Competencies

**WORK ENVIRONMENT**

When applicable and appropriate, consideration will be given to reasonable accommodations.

**Mental:** Clear and conceptual thinking ability; excellent judgment and discretion; ability to handle work-related stress; ability to handle multiple priorities simultaneously; and ability to meet deadlines

**Physical:** Computer keyboarding, travel as required

**Auditory/Visual:** Hearing, vision and talking
